Description:
- This is the city's coolest sushi joint decorated in minimalist black and red hues with a view of the bustling street. It's equally busy inside, as chefs prepare fresh fish and dazzlingly innovative Maki rolls, such as the Godzilla, Crystal Rainbow and spicy TNT Maki. It's a good place for couples to unwind with some saki. Solo diners can saddle up to the tiny sushi bar, where expert sushi masters entertain you as they dice and roll the night away.
